Chef Martin Boetz creates a sweet and spicy combination of pork and prawn, wrapped in a delicate egg net. Highly-acclaimed as one of the flagships of “modern Thai” in Sydney, Longrain is a smart space in Sydney’s Surry Hills – big bar, communal tables, fresh, innovative food.

The creative forces of chef and co-owner Martin Boetz combine Thai and Southern Chinese influences. German-born Boetz was significantly influenced by David Thompson at Darley Street Thai (now closed) and later at Sailors Thai, which Martin ran for several years.

Glossary

Juniper Berries

A tangy, aromatic dark red-purple berry used to flavour meat marinades and stews. It is also used to make gin.
